How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Woodside?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Woodside Studio Apartments | $2,910 | $1,700 | $10,000+ |
| Woodside 1 Bedroom Apartments | $3,114 | $1,500 | $6,340 |
| Woodside 2 Bedroom Apartments | $4,717 | $2,300 | $10,000+ |
Woodside 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,891 | $2,800 | $7,199 |
| Woodside 4 Bedroom Apartments | $4,491 | $3,200 | $6,999 |
| Woodside 5 Bedroom Apartments | $5,199 | $5,199 | $5,199 |
| Woodside 6 Bedroom Apartments | $11,500 | $10,000 | $10,000+ |

Frequently Asked Questions about 3 Bedroom Woodside Apartments
What is the Cheapest apartment in Woodside with 3 Bedroom?
Currently the most affordable 3 Bedroom in Woodside is at LeFrak City listed at $3,875.
How much is the average rent for a 3 Bedroom Woodside Apartment?
The average rent for a 3 Bedroom Apartment in Woodside is $3,891.
What is the largest available 3 Bedroom Woodside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in Woodside is a 1,350 square feet unit starting from $4,500 at 2575 22nd St.
What is the average size for Woodside 3 Bedroom Apartments for rent?
The average size for a 3 Bedroom rental in Woodside is currently 1,389 sq ft.
